Rationally Speaking #198 - Timur Kuran on "Private Truths and Public Lies"
from Rationally Speaking Podcast · host NYC Skeptics
In this episode, economist Timur Kuran explains the ubiquitous phenomenon of "preference falsification" -- in which people claim to support something publicly even though they don't support it privately -- and describes its harmful effects on society. He and Julia explore questions like: Is preference falsification all bad? Are there ways to reduce it? And how much has the Internet changed the dynamics around preference falsification?
